Is there anyway to take the fonts installed on a server and place them into the pages viewed by clients?

Not quite, but this might help:-
http://www.microsoft.com/typography/web/embedding/weft2/weft1.htm
You can create fonts to be downloaded to the client
only IE right now, IIRC.
Netscape also supports downloaded fonts for use with CSS. Naturally, it 
uses a different format than IE's. See:
http://www.truedoc.com/webpages/intro/
